Abstract

Special Skraup procedures have been developed for the synthesis of a series of new 3- phenyl-5-quinolinecarboxylic esters. These esters have been employed as starting materials for the elaboration of a series of cu-dialkylaminomethyl-3-phenyl-5-quinolinemethanols via the corresponding acid chlorides, diazo ketones, bromo ketones, and epoxides.
